    Job description

    Purpose

    As IT Partner you provide professional and high quality service to all business units in site including IT & systems support, trainings, office equipment standards and operations. You lead implementation of digital solutions and contribution in global IT projects.

    Assignment

    • To perform and manage planned activities, such as IT installations, upgrades, local rebuilds and maintenance activities according to agreed goals, defined strategies, budget and overall IT investments. Perform preventive maintenance and routine monitoring to ensure continuous uptime of the onsite IT infrastructure.

    • To take necessary decisions and actions to solve issues, as well as priorities issues according to business needs in close co-operation with the global Single Point of Contact (Helpdesk) in an efficient and professional manner issues and know when and how to escalate it in the support chain.

    • To perform all daily tasks according to set procedures, rules and guidelines and ensure that they are aligned within the organization and secure IT communication towards co-workers on site.

    • To provide technical training for onsite support staff and for new hires, including setting up and introducing technical equipment (e.g., laptops). Act as a Digital Workplace ambassador on site.

    • For local IT security in close co-operation with risk management and information security.

    • To take proactive approach towards possible risks and opportunities in the area of IT and act as a subject matter expert in this field. Monitor the development of IT technologies and system trends and evaluate their possible business benefits.

    • To manage relationships with Inter IKEA IT, vendors, contractors, service providers and other stakeholders regarding support, upgrades, bug reporting, change requests, etc. when needed.

    • To continuously work with improvements and actively participate in applicable Workplace Operation Network


    Qualification

    • Service-minded and professional, focusing on end users' needs and Inter IKEA business operations.

    • Enjoy identifying and proposing improvements to IT processes and tools.

    • Motivated to take initiative, provide outstanding IT support, and solve problems seamlessly with IT Delivery.

    • Experience in project management tools and methodology.

    • Fluent in English (written and verbal)

    • Self-reliant and motivated with a proven ability to work as part of a team as well as independently.
